2. High-Performance Trading Engine
The trading engine is the core component of a cryptocurrency exchange.
It is responsible for:
Order matching
Trade execution
Price calculations
Transaction processing
An efficient trading engine should provide:
Low latency
High throughput
Real-time processing
Scalability during market volatility
Even a slight delay in order execution can significantly impact the user experience.

5. Liquidity Management System
Liquidity is one of the biggest challenges for newly launched cryptocurrency exchanges.
Without sufficient liquidity:
Order execution becomes difficult
Slippage increases
User satisfaction decreases
To address this, exchanges often integrate:
Liquidity Providers
Market Makers
Shared Order Books
Liquidity APIs
A strong liquidity strategy helps create a seamless trading experience.
